A Maine motor vehicle bill of sale (sometimes called a State of Maine bill of sale) is a legal document that records the transfer of ownership of a vehicle from the seller to the buyer. According to the latest Maine BMV guidelines and 29-A M.R.S. § 652, a valid Maine bill of sale vehicle Maine transaction must include:
| Required Element | Legal Basis |
|---|---|
| Seller’s name and address | 29-A M.R.S. § 652 |
| Buyer’s name and address | 29-A M.R.S. § 652 |
| Vehicle description (year, make, model, VIN) | Federal Odometer Act & Maine law |
| Odometer reading (exact mileage) | 49 CFR § 580 & Maine BMV Form MVT-32 |
| Sale price | Maine Revenue Services sales tax |
| Date of sale | 29-A M.R.S. § 652 |
| Signatures of buyer and seller | 29-A M.R.S. § 652 |
Maine does not require notarization of a standard motor vehicle bill of sale in 2025.

Step 1 – Vehicle Information
Enter the exact year, make, model, and 17-digit VIN from the title. For a motorcycle bill of sale Maine, include the engine size if desired.
Step 2 – Odometer Reading
Federal law requires an accurate odometer disclosure for vehicles less than 10 years old. Check the correct box (“Actual,” “Exceeds,” or “Not Actual”).
Step 3 – Sale Price
Be honest. Maine Revenue Services cross-checks with NADA and Kelley Blue Book. Under-reporting to save on the 5.5% sales tax can trigger penalties and interest.
Step 4 – “As-Is” Clause
Maine private-party vehicle sales are almost always “as-is” unless you specifically write in a warranty. This clause protects the seller from post-sale complaints.
